Police Should Be Thanked for the Handling of Karur Stampede, Says Kamal Haasan
Kamal Haasan praised police for their swift response to the Karur stampede that killed 41 and urged accountability while cautioning against politicizing the tragedy.
- On Monday, Makkal Needhi Maiam chief Kamal Haasan visited the Karur stampede site at Velusamypuram and met bereaved families, urging organisers to accept responsibility and apologise.
- On September 27, a rally led by TVK founder Vijay in Karur turned deadly, killing 41 people and injuring over 50 amid more than 30,000 attendees at a ground meant for 3,000.
- After the High Court order, a Special Investigation Team led by Inspector General Asra Garg and a one-member inquiry commission were formed, and police arrested two people including district secretary Mathiyazhagan.
- Officials and courts moved to tighten controls, with the Madras High Court rebuking Vijay and imposing a temporary ban on highway rallies until an SOP is framed, while Haasan praised Chief Minister M.K. Stalin's response.
- AIADMK leader Edappadi K. Palaniswami accused the DMK government of `double standards`, contrasting swift Karur probe with delayed kidney trafficking investigations flagged by the Madras High Court.
